LuminUltra, a leader in molecular testing, has partnered with Kikkoman Biochemifa to improve food safety monitoring in North America. This collaboration brings advanced tools to help ensure cleanliness in food production.
LuminUltra will now distribute Kikkoman’s top food safety testing solutions, including:
A3 Hygiene Monitoring System: This system goes beyond traditional ATP tests by detecting ATP, ADP, and AMP. This feature provides a detailed view of surface cleanliness, which is essential for industries like ready-to-eat meals, dairy, and meat where sanitization is critical.
Easy Plate™: This is a user-friendly culture-based solution that simplifies pathogen detection. It cuts prep time and makes testing more accessible, eliminating the need for special equipment.
